KUALA LUMPUR (Dow Jones)--Argentina's 2009 soybean production will likely
fall to 42.5 million metric tons from 46.2 million in 2008, Thomas Mielke,
editor-in-chief of Hamburg-based Oil World, said Thursday.
South American soybean production this year will likely be 106 million tons,
down from 115 million tons last year and off earlier expectations of 118
million tons, Mielke said in a pre-recorded speech broadcast at a vegetable
oils conference. Brazil's output will likely be 57 million tons, he added.
The shortfall due to drought in Argentina will be partly offset by carryover
inventories from last year, he said.
